Abstract :
A beamforming method for estimation of the direction-of-arrival (DOA) and distance in the presence of impulsive noise using a phased array with antenna switching is proposed. The proposed robust beamformer is nonlinear in nature and uses the absolute value loss function. Experiment results demonstrate that the proposed method is satisfactorily verified using experimental data from the developed 24 GHz phased array system with antenna switching.
